Before You Go
Bring a change of clothes
Expect mud and water after the ATVs and cenote—pack dry clothes and a towel for the return trip.
Hydrate before you arrive
The jungle is humid and exerting; drink water ahead and carry a refillable bottle for the day.
Wear closed-toe shoes
ATV trails have roots and rocks—sturdy shoes with grip protect your feet while riding.
Use reef-safe sunscreen
Apply sunscreen but avoid contaminants in the cenote water—choose mineral-based formulas.

Conservation Note
Operators typically limit group sizes and ask guests not to introduce sunscreen or trash into cenotes; choose providers who follow local water-conservation guidelines.
Cenotes were central to Mayan life and ritual—many served as freshwater sources and ceremonial sites, and nearby trails often follow ancient routes.

Common Questions
Is transportation included?
Round transportation from Cancún is included; pickup details are collected at booking.
Can I drive an ATV?
Drivers 16+ may operate an ATV with an adult companion; single-rider ATVs require age 18+ and meet the weight limit.
What are the age and weight limits?
Minimum age for participants is 4; ATV drivers must meet age requirements and the maximum weight limit is 130 kg (286 lb).
What happens in bad weather?
The cancellation policy requires 24+ hours for a full refund; operators may continue in light rain but will close activities if conditions are unsafe.
